The company says that a limited number of these MacBook Pro models, units feature a component, that can fail and in reaction can cause the built-in battery to expand.
Numerous affected laptops may not have experienced a swollen battery at this time, but Apple explains that it has identified a component that can fail and result in damage to the built-in battery. Affected units were manufactured between October 2016 and October 2017 and eligibility is determined by the product serial number.

This issue is not present on older 13-inch MacBook Pro models or the 13-inch MacBook Pros with Touch Bar. To check if your MacBook Pro is eligible for this, you will need to enter in your MacBook Pro's serial number on Apple's support page and hit submit. After that, it's a matter of 3 to 5 days for service to take place.
Apple, however, will not extend the standard warranty coverage of the devices. Also, any customers that have already paid for a replacement battery for their affected laptop can contact Apple Support about a refund.
